About the Role:

We’re looking for a hands-on Fire & Safety Officer with 2–3 years of experience in chemical, petrochemical, distillery, or similar hazardous process industries. This role is execution-focused and operational. You will be responsible for implementing safety systems, managing hazardous chemical handling procedures (including denatured alcohol), ensuring statutory compliance, and driving a strong safety culture within a growing manufacturing environment.

What You’ll Do
1. Hazardous Chemical Handling & Process Safety

  • Develop and implement SOPs for safe loading, unloading, storage, and transfer of hazardous chemicals, including denatured alcohol
  • Supervise and monitor chemical handling operations to ensure compliance with safety norms
  • Develop safety guidelines for operators working with flammable solvents and pressure equipment
  • Conduct job safety analysis (JSA) and risk assessments for critical activities

2. Inventory Compliance & Regulatory Reporting

  • Maintain accurate records of Denatured Alcohol (DNA) inventory
  • Prepare compliance-related reports and documentation for regulatory authorities
  • Ensure proper documentation of storage, consumption, and movement of hazardous chemicals
  • Coordinate with authorities for inspections, renewals, and approvals related to fire and hazardous chemical compliance

3. Fire Safety Systems & Emergency Preparedness

  • Ensure proper functioning and periodic maintenance of fire safety systems, including:
    • Hydrant networks
    • Fire extinguishers
    • Foam systems
    • Detection and alarm systems
  • Conduct periodic inspections and testing of fire protection equipment
  • Support the development and implementation of the On-Site Emergency Plan
  • Conduct mock drills and emergency response exercises

4. Shop Floor Safety & PPE Management

  • Develop and implement safety guidelines for shop-floor operators and contractors
  • Manage PPE inventory, issuance, and compliance monitoring
  • Ensure proper usage of PPE in hazardous zones

5. Training, Audits & Continuous Improvement

  • Conduct safety inductions and refresher training programs
  • Carry out internal safety inspections and audits
  • Investigate incidents, near-misses, and unsafe conditions
  • Drive corrective and preventive actions (CAPA)
  • Maintain safety records and prepare periodic reports for management
